Located in the Conejo Valley between Los Angeles and Santa Barbara, Thousand Oaks combines suburban living with natural surroundings. The city is home to thousands of protected oak trees and maintains more than one-third of its land as preserved open space. Residents enjoy 150 miles of trails perfect for outdoor recreation throughout the area's natural landscapes. Housing options include properties in the North Ranch area and apartments along Thousand Oaks Boulevard, with current rental rates averaging $2,582 for a one-bedroom apartment, reflecting a 0.82% decrease from the previous year.
The city serves as headquarters for Amgen, a major biotechnology company, contributing to the area's strong economic foundation. The Civic Arts Plaza and Fred Kavli Theatre anchor the downtown cultural scene with regular performances and events.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
